What is Hawaiian Barbecue?
Hawaiian Barbecue is a term used to stylize the Hawaiian islands’ plate lunch.  A typical plate lunch consists of a meat entrée, 2 scoops of white rice and a scoop of macaroni salad. Popular meat entrées include chicken katsu, barbecued beef short ribs and a barbecued chicken leg. In areas where fresh seafood is available, fried shrimp and mahi mahi are also common.
